Bentham Science publishes 5th volume of Frontiers in Clinical Drug Research — Anti Infectives

Bioengineer by Bioengineer
July 16, 2019
in Health
Reading Time: 2 mins read
0
Share on FacebookShare on TwitterShare on LinkedinShare on RedditShare on Telegram

The series brings more updates on anti-infective medicine for readers

The scope of the book series covers a range of topics including the chemistry, pharmacology, molecular biology and biochemistry of natural and synthetic drugs employed in the treatment of infectious diseases. Reviews in this series also include research on multi drug resistance and pre-clinical / clinical findings on novel antibiotics, vaccines, antifungal agents and antitubercular agents.

Frontiers in Clinical Drug Research – Anti Infectives is a valuable resource for pharmaceutical scientists and postgraduate students seeking updated and critically important information for developing clinical trials and devising research plans in the field of anti infective drug discovery and epidemiology.

The fifth volume of this series features six reviews which cover research on the discovery of new anti infective resources from marine environments, fecal transplantation, new advances in anti-biotic development, and treatment options for UTIs and mycobacteria. The full list of reviews is :

  • Integrated Approaches for Marine Actinomycete Biodiscovery
  • Therapeutic Use of Commensal Microbes: Fecal/Gut Microbiota Transplantation
  • Alternative Approaches to Antimicrobials
  • Nanoantibiotics: Recent Developments and Future
  • Cranberry Juice and Other Functional Foods in Urinary Tract Infections in Women: A Review of Actual Evidence and Main Challenges
  • Targeting Magnesium Homeostasis as Potential Anti-Infective Strategy Against Mycobacteria

The latest volume of this series gives a broad picture of the efforts researchers are undertaking to combat infectious microorganisms.

About The Editors:

Atta-ur-Rahman, Ph.D. in organic chemistry from Cambridge University (1968), has 1142 international publications in several fields of organic chemistry including 775 research publications, 43 international patents, 70 chapters in books and 256 books published largely by major U.S. and European presses. He is the Editor-in-Chief of eight European Chemistry journals. He is Editor of the world’s leading encyclopedic series of volumes on natural products “Studies in Natural Product Chemistry” 60 volumes of which have been published under his Editorship by Elsevier during the last two decades.

M. Iqbal Choudhary is a Ph. D. scientist in the field of organic chemistry from Pakistan working at the University of Karachi. He is known for his research in bioorganic chemistry and natural product chemistry. He has more than 900 research publications, including 33 books published.
